I'm looking to build a laptop in order to be able to work with CC in a portable setting. I have a camera that we still use that shoots on Mini-DV. At the office we capture the video into the desktop through firewire using a cheap canon camcorder for playback. With laptops not coming with firewire input, is there a way to be able to capture the footage from the mini-dv to a newly built laptop? We would be building a PC.

As far as I know, no version of Premiere will capture using a USB port, only firewire
Capture is not the same as using a USB port (with your operating system file manager) to copy files
